Researchers Hack a Corvette Using SMS Messages

"Presenting their research paper at the USENIX WOOT 2015 conference in Washington, the four showed how the tracking dongles used by many companies like Metromile (car insurance) and Uber can be easily reverse-engineered and controlled via SMS."
